The Facilities Unit Director will interact with customers, devise strategies to ensure the organization meets its goals, and oversee the daily operational activities of the facilities team. This role requires problem-solving, communication, and leadership skills to effectively manage the team and facilities.
Requirements
- Develop and manage a preventative and corrective maintenance management program utilizing an up-to-date CMMS system
- Inspect facility and generate reports as required
- Assist in planning best allocation and utilization of space and resources
- Prepare documents for maintenance and vendor selections
- Ensure that all in-house and contracted personnel are appropriately trained for the work they are performing
- Develop and Maintain an accurate library of building and system drawings
- Assist in coordination of projects with property management teams
- Assist in development of policies and procedures
- Coordinate and lead team members
- Assist in development and upkeep of safety systems & programs
- Respond appropriately to emergencies or urgent issues
- Perform facility safety and general condition walk thru
- Ensure Shipping/Receiving and mail is delivered in a timely manner
- Oversight of confidential document shredding program
- Ensure landscaping and grounds are maintained as designed
